Intel Corporation is a leading technology company focused on engineering a brighter future through world-changing technology. The role of the Senior Logic Design Engineer involves designing and integrating IP for custom silicon solutions, collaborating with architecture teams, and ensuring high standards in silicon design and verification.
Responsibilities:
- Designing and/or integrating IP for Intel's Custom Silicon solutions
- You will be working or assisting in architecture, design, implementation, formal verification, emulation and validation
- Creating a design to produce key assets that help improve product KPIs for discrete graphics products
- Working with SoC Architecture and platform architecture teams to establish silicon requirements
- Making appropriate design trade off balancing risk, area, power, performance, validation complexity and schedule
- Creating micro architectural specification document for the design
- Working with external vendors on tools or IPs required for the development of micro-architecture, design and design qualification of custom silicon designs
- Driving vendor's methodology to meet world class silicon design standards
- Architecting area and power efficient low latency designs with scalabilities and flexibilities
- Power and Area efficient RTL logic design and DV support
- Running tools to ensure lint-free and CDC/RDC clean design, VCLP
- Synthesis and timing constraints
- Reviews the verification plan and implementation to ensure design features are verified correctly and resolves and implements corrective measures for failing RTL tests to ensure correctness of features
Requirements:
- Bachelor's degree in Computer Science, Electrical Engineering, Computer Engineering, or a related field with 3+ years of relevant experience
- Master's degree in the same fields with 2+ years of relevant experience
- PhD in the same fields
- Experience with complex IP/ASIC/SOC Design Implementation
- Experience in system and processor architecture
- Experience with System Verilog/SOC development environment
- Experience in scripting languages (i.e. PERL, TCL, or Python)
- Experience with Hardware validation techniques (i.e. formal Verification, Test and Function Verification)
- Experience designing and implementing complex blocks like CPUs, GPU, Media blocks, and Memory controller
- Experience in leading small team of engineers
- Experience with Industry standard protocols (i.e. PCIE, USB, DDR, etc)
- Experience with interaction of computer hardware with software
- Experience with Low power/UPF implementation/verification techniques
- Experience with Formal verification techniques